New Haven is home to Yale University and Yale New Haven Health System — Connecticut's largest healthcare provider and one of the nation's top academic medical centers. Yale New Haven Hospital is nationally ranked in multiple specialties including neurology, rehabilitation, and pediatrics. The Hospital of Saint Raphael (now part of Yale New Haven) adds capacity. Smilow Cancer Hospital provides oncology rehabilitation. The Yale Child Study Center is a world-renowned institution for developmental assessment and research — it pioneered the Comer School Development Program for social-emotional learning. Southern Connecticut State University trains OT and education professionals. The VA Connecticut Healthcare System's West Haven campus serves veterans with TBI, PTSD, and rehabilitation needs. The Connecticut Autism Spectrum Resource Center provides statewide support. New Haven's diverse population — significant African American, Hispanic, and immigrant communities — requires culturally responsive therapy approaches.
